Tube Number Code System

Example: M-11045.180100.00

M 11 045 180 100 00
Fin Height
M=Medium H=High L=Low
Minimum Fins per Inch Fin Height in 1/10 mm Minimum Root Diameter in 1/10 mm Root Wall-thickness in 1/100 mm Inner Surface Code
00=plain 01=Undulated 02=Grooved
Manufacturing Process
  1. Raw material procurement based on customer specifications
  2. Incoming material quality inspection
  3. Precision roll forming with continuous process monitoring
  4. Custom length cutting and finishing
  5. Comprehensive specification verification
  6. Optional secondary processing: de-fin, soft annealing, bending, coiling, welding
  7. Final cleaning, pressure testing, drying, and packaging
Technical Specifications
Parameter Range
Fin Height 0-12mm
Fins per Inch 5-26
Fin Thickness 0.3-0.5mm
Wall Thickness 0.7-2mm
Custom OD/ID Available per requirements
Available Materials

Copper (C10200, C12000, C12200), Copper Nickel (C70600), Aluminum (1060), Aluminum alloy, and various bimetallic combinations including Aluminum-Steel, Aluminum-Stainless Steel, Aluminum-Copper, Aluminum-Copper Nickel, and Copper-Copper Nickel.

Industry Applications
  • Heating systems: gas-fired boilers, condensing boilers, flue gas condensers
  • Mechanical and automotive engineering: oil coolers, mine coolers, air coolers for diesel engines
  • Chemical engineering: gas coolers and heaters, process coolers
  • Power plants: air coolers, cooling towers
  • Nuclear engineering: uranium enrichment plants
  • HVAC and refrigeration: condensers, evaporators, water heaters
